Job description

Blue Arrow are currently working with a large public sector organisation for the requirement of 2 x Health and Safety Advisors based in and around the outskirts of Glasgow. You will be working across a number of departments so there will be high level of variety within these positions. Both roles are on a permanent basis, with interviews and start dates to commence ASAP.

Salary: 39,000 to 44,500

Hours: Monday to Friday, 9am to 5pm

Location: Office / WFH / On–site based

Key Skills and Experience Required :–

  • Developing and implementing a compliant health and safety management system
  • Knowledge of health and safety legislation and its practical applications
  • Managing health and safety in the construction and/or utility sectors
  • Practical application of knowledge across the key areas of the role: production of risk assessments and method statements, COSHH assessments, incident and accident investigation, undertake inspections and audits, communicate statutory requirements to line managers

Education

  • Hold or be working towards NEBOSH Diploma or NCRQ equivalent or Graduate Member of IOSH or (member, graduate) of a related professional institute e.g. IEMA, IIRSM or Degree in Health & Safety or BSc degree in a related subject and, where applicable, working towards vocational qualifications e.g NEBOSH or IOSH

Key Duties

  • Contribute to addressing the impact of work on health and of health on work to ensure and facilitate the prevention of accidents and promotion of health and safety
  • Support the Health and Safety Manager and ensure that the service provision conforms to recognised Health & Safety good practice guidance
  • Take a lead role in the monitoring, reporting and reviewing of Health and Safety standards and that stakeholders are advised on levels of compliance with statutory requirements reporting this to the appropriate bodies
  • Proactively contribute to the ongoing review and development of the Health & Safety policies and procedures to ensure these are appropriate and in accordance with relevant legislation
  • Implement a programme of working that provides Health & Safety advice, solutions, and coaching to ensure that managers and responsible officers are aware of their responsibilities to Health and Safety and can demonstrate compliance
  • Support the performance of the Health and Safety Team through a culture of team work and flexibility, contributing to the overall success
  • Work to continuously improve service delivery and performance of the Health and Safety Team
